Principles of Healthy Child Development 4-hour (PHCD 4-hour)

Register Here for Virtual Live training!

The Principles of Healthy Child Development (PHCD) is a 4-hour training that equips front-line leaders (anyone working with children aged 4 to 12) with the tools to immediately enhance the quality of their programs. The training provides valuable information, resources, and techniques to ensure that each child's social, emotional, and cognitive needs are met. 

Learner Outcomes
At the completion of this training, learners will be able to:

  • create meaningful relationships with the children in their programs by using the activities, information on child development, and resources provided in the training; 
  • speak a common language with their fellow staff that is based on prioritizing the developmental needs of the child; and
  • develop a child-centred program.

Principles of Healthy Child Development Modules

Three modules have been developed to complement PHCD 4-hour.

Communicating with Empathy

  • This module highlights various techniques and tips to help frontline leaders navigate communication with children, parents/caregivers, co-workers and supervisors.
  • Highlights Include: understanding and practicing the principles of empathetic listening and communication, understanding how be an active listener and how non-verbal communication influences a conversation.
